Did you know?

Butterflies undergo one of nature's most remarkable transformations, metamorphosing through complete life stages from egg to caterpillar to chrysalis to winged adult. Their distinctive symmetrical wings serve both beauty and function, with intricate patterns that help species recognition and sometimes provide camouflage or warning coloration to predators.

Pattern description

Butterflies have long captivated needleworkers with their symmetrical beauty and graceful form. This counted cross-stitch pattern captures a classic design with a bold, jewel-toned dark burgundy body and wings rendered in vibrant hot pink and sunny yellow.

The 30×30 stitch count makes this an ideal beginner project, working up quickly on Aida fabric with just three DMC thread colors. The geometric precision of the pattern showcases how even simple shapes—when stitched with careful color placement—create dynamic visual impact. Perfect as a small gift, a charm for a larger piece, or a colorful accent on a child's room decoration.

Material Type: Aida Generic White

Sewing Count: 8/inch or 31/100mm

Design Size: 30 x 13 stitches

Sewn Design Size: 3.8 x 1.6 inches or 95 x 41 mm

Suggested Material Size: 9.7 x 7.5 inches or 245 x 191 mm

Stitch Style: Cross-stitch Using 4 strands
